Tantalum (Ta) is a dense and ductile refractory steel Utilized in applications which involve its thermal general performance, chemical resistance, or bio-compatibility [1, two]. Additive manufacturing lowers the price of utilization for refractory metals by minimizing substance squander and machining time. It lets the creation of novel parts in a broad-array of purposes that will capitalize on the fabric properties of tantalum and its alloys, specially in aerospace and health-related. The purposes in these industries are exacting, and to attain the specified general performance from printed elements the consistency and purity of your powder is paramount.
The lessened metal is cleaned to get rid of salts from the reduction approach and after that pressed into billets for electron beam (EB) melting. The steel is melted at above four,000°C to remove most metallic impurities (besides other refractories) and interstitial components. The significant-purity ingot is hydrided to make it brittle, crushed, and milled to dimension and degassed back again to steel. Each of those techniques necessitates mindful things to consider to prevent the introduction of FOD, cross-contamination from other items, and oxide/nitride formation. Consideration to depth during the purification and powder preparing steps results in premium quality feedstock for subsequent processing.
